Our company, Yamagishi Manufacturing Co., Ltd., specializes in the processing and manufacturing of needle bearings and excels in the technology of thin-walled cutting among precision machine parts. We are particularly skilled in producing products with an extremely high roundness, achieving roundness of 0.05mm or less, and we can process sizes ranging from a diameter of 5mm to 400mm. Additionally, in the field of prototype development, we provide high-precision cutting and polishing technology that accommodates small-lot, diverse production. 【Business Activities】 ■ Thin-Walled Cutting Processing Business Precision cutting processing of thin-walled products using proprietary technology (lathe, machining) ■ Single Item Polishing Processing Business Processing business from cutting to polishing of single round items ■ Dimensional Measurement and Inspection Contracting Business Preparation of inspection reports *For more details, please refer to the external link page or feel free to contact us.
